Output 68dfe259fc77a0f928b58066e701602e736d5df3f293d187d7612e66db05ce27:1

value
844494117
script pubkey
OP_0 OP_PUSHBYTES_20 dfa30db8bf216915d872504a1e90064c9cd9f63b
address
bc1qm73smw9ly953tkrj2p9payqxfjwdna3m8gpuzm
transaction
68dfe259fc77a0f928b58066e701602e736d5df3f293d187d7612e66db05ce27
spent
true